This renames a lot of configuration keys. Is it not possible to do it a bit
less invasive? Rename the `taskmanager.heap.size` to `taskmanager.jvm.size` and
keep the rest?
We have to be clear and careful with the term managed memory also, as the
regular JVM heap is managed memory (managed by the JVM / GC) as opposed to the
unmanaged memory in a C++ program.
